Acidic polysaccharides are polysaccharides that contain acidic functional groups, such as carboxyl or sulfate groups. These functional groups confer a negative charge to the molecule, making acidic polysaccharides important in various biological processes such as cell signaling and interactions. Examples include hyaluronic acid and pectin.
Acetone is commonly used to precipitate polysaccharides because it causes the polysaccharides to become insoluble and separate out of solution. This method is effective for isolating and purifying polysaccharides from other components in a sample. Additionally, acetone is volatile and can be easily removed, leaving behind the purified polysaccharides.

No, lipids are not polysaccharides. Lipids are a diverse group of molecules that are insoluble in water, whereas polysaccharides are complex carbohydrates composed of long chains of monosaccharides. Lipids include substances like fats, oils, and phospholipids, while polysaccharides include starch, cellulose, and glycogen.
